How This Fake Word Generator Works

This tool uses a prebuilt offline naming system: English-friendly syllable patterns, Greek and Latin roots, fantasy sound clusters, sci-fi consonants, affixes, vowel balancing, and brand-name length scoring. The browser generates every result locally.

Professional namers often combine methods: compounding, clipping, blending, suffixing, sound symbolism, and phonetic cleanup. This generator runs those methods without sending your inputs anywhere.

Portmanteau Blends

Blends join the front of one word with the end of another, then smooth the join so the result is easier to say and remember.

Morpheme Compounds

Morphemes carry meaning. Roots such as lumin, aero, neo, terra, and vita help fake words feel familiar without being real dictionary words.

Sound Symbolism

Soft styles favor sounds such as l, m, n, v, and open vowels. Hard styles use k, t, g, x, z, and short vowel shapes for sharper names.

Pronounceability Checks

The script reduces awkward triples, balances vowels, removes repeated letters, and scores each result for length, rhythm, and mouth-feel.
